**Understanding Bitcoin Wallets
**Before diving into the process of moving bitcoins between wallets, it's important to understand the different types of wallets available. Bitcoin wallets can be categorized into three main types: software wallets, hardware wallets, and web wallets.
- **Software Wallets**: These are applications installed on your computer or smartphone that allow you to send, receive, and store bitcoins. Examples include Electrum, Bitcoin Core, and Mycelium.
- **Hardware Wallets**: These are physical devices designed specifically for storing cryptocurrencies. They offer a high level of security by keeping your private keys offline. Popular hardware wallets include Ledger Nano S and Trezor.
- **Web Wallets**: These are online services that allow you to access your bitcoins through a web browser. While convenient, they may pose a higher security risk compared to software or hardware wallets.
